Head to head by decade
| Decade | China | Saudi Arabia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 0.0408 | 0.9568 | 0.916 | Saudi Arabia |
| 2010s | 0.0012 | 0.0277 | 0.0265 | Saudi Arabia |
| 2020s | 0 | 0.0083 | 0.0083 | Saudi Arabia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
